AI technologies play a key role in connecting patients with healthcare providers. By using tools such as virtual health assistants, chatbots, and intelligent contact center solutions, medical practices improve operational efficiency and patient experiences.
AI-powered virtual health assistants provide immediate responses to patient inquiries through voice calls, texts, and chat interfaces. These tools decrease response times, resulting in higher patient satisfaction. For instance, First Choice Neurology uses the healow Genie AI solution to automate over 35,000 monthly incoming calls. Patients can access health information 24/7, managing their appointments and medications independently.
AI-driven chatbots offer real-time support, helping patients with common questions and appointment scheduling. They also remind patients about medications to improve adherence. With these advancements, healthcare providers can address complaints regarding long wait times and poor communication, creating a smoother experience for those seeking care.
AI can analyze large datasets to create customized treatment plans based on individual health records. By recognizing patterns and potential risks, AI helps healthcare providers deliver accurate diagnoses and interventions tailored to patient needs. For example, AI solutions in telemedicine examine electronic health records (EHRs) to develop treatment plans, minimizing the risk of adverse reactions and improving patient outcomes.
The growing use of AI in healthcare enhances accessibility, especially for patients with chronic conditions or those in rural areas with limited facilities.
AI-enabled remote monitoring devices allow healthcare providers to track vital signs in real time, identifying potential health issues early. This proactive method is crucial for managing chronic conditions, where timely interventions can prevent complications and hospitalizations. These devices support a healthcare model focused on prevention and continuous care, which is essential for the aging population and those with ongoing medical needs.
Combining telemedicine with AI solutions facilitates access to healthcare. By monitoring patients remotely, medical practices ensure that individuals with mobility challenges can receive care without visiting the hospital. These AI solutions improve access to care and support chronic condition management, addressing the rising prevalence of chronic illnesses in the U.S.

AI technologies benefit not only patient-facing interactions but also administrative functions, relieving burdens on healthcare staff.
By automating tasks like appointment scheduling and data entry, AI lessens the workload for healthcare professionals, allowing more time for patient care. For example, the healow Genie solution handles routine inquiries autonomously, enabling staff to focus on complex tasks that require human attention.
AI can help in processing insurance claims, simplifying a typically complex process. Efficient claims handling reduces administrative overhead, ensures timely reimbursements for healthcare providers, and improves the financial health of a medical practice.
Machine learning algorithms analyze patient data trends to forecast service demands and identify areas for improvement. For instance, healthcare practices can use AI to anticipate busy periods, allowing for better staffing management and adjustment of operational hours to meet patient needs effectively. This capability contributes to improved accessibility and operational efficiency.

Looking ahead, the AI healthcare market is expected to grow from $11 billion in 2021 to an estimated $187 billion by 2030. This growth highlights the increasing recognition of AI’s role in improving treatment outcomes, enhancing operational efficiency, and providing better patient experiences.
Advancements in AI are set to further improve patient safety by enhancing diagnostics and facilitating early disease detection. AI systems, like IBM’s Watson, analyze clinical data accurately, aiding providers in making informed decisions and potentially minimizing errors.
Despite promising benefits, challenges such as data privacy, accuracy, and integration with current IT systems remain. Addressing these challenges is crucial for realizing AI’s full potential in healthcare. Organizations must prioritize risk management, protect patient data, and maintain transparency in the algorithms used in AI systems.
